    My Column A contains person's name and a title of that person

    Example:
    Column A
    (Cell 1) Abraham John Mr.
    (Cell 2) Jones Patricia Mrs.
    (Cell 3) Baldwin Gloria Ms.
    (Cell 4) Thomas Reggie

    In Column B I want a formula which would search for Mr. Mrs. and Ms. and If it finds any of the three words, then it should return as true or it should return false.

    I know this can be done using the find command but I am not able to nest it properly and use it to find all the three words in 1 cell.

    So the output for the first 3 cells of Column A would be True and for Cell 4 would be false.

    Various options, one might be:

    =ISNUMBER(LOOKUP(9.99E+307,--SEARCH({"Mr.","Mrs.","Ms."},A1)))
    copied down

    (swap SEARCH for FIND if you wish for Mr. <> mr. )

    Try:

    =OR(ISNUMBER(SEARCH({"Mr.","Mrs.","Ms."},A1)))

    where A1 contains string.
